What is in a noble gas?

A noble gas is an element found in group 18 of the periodic table. They are helium, neon, argon, krypton, xenon, and radon.

Why do neon signs contain other noble gases besides neon?

Neon signs are red-orange any other color may be called neon signs, but actually have another gas in them. each noble gas produces a different color when electricity is sent through they contain only one gas at a time
